Is Oak Ridge a good place to live?
Yes, Oak Ridge is considered a great place to live, especially given its low crime rates, strong community, and economic stability. The city has a population of approximately 29,124 residents, with a median household income of $55,869 and an average home value of $157,912. The unemployment rate is relatively low at 4.1%, and the poverty rate stands at 15.6%. The city's neighborhoods, particularly The Preserve at Clinch River and Emory Valley, are rated as some of the safest in the region, making Oak Ridge an appealing choice for families, singles, and retirees seeking a secure and community-oriented environment.
